
Introduction
Quantitative trading (also known as quant trading) is a type of trading that uses mathematical models and computer programs to make trading decisions. Quant traders use historical data to develop models that can predict future price movements. These models are then used to generate trading signals, which are then executed by computer programs.
AI quantitative trading is a type of quantitative trading that uses artificial intelligence (AI) to make trading decisions. AI quantitative trading algorithms are typically more complex than traditional quantitative trading algorithms, and they can learn and adapt over time.
Benefits of AI Quantitative Trading
There are a number of benefits to using AI quantitative trading, including:
- Greater accuracy: AI quantitative trading algorithms can be more accurate than traditional quantitative trading algorithms, due to their ability to learn and adapt over time.
- Faster execution: AI quantitative trading algorithms can execute trades much faster than human traders, which can be important in volatile markets.
- Reduced risk: AI quantitative trading algorithms can help to reduce risk by removing human emotions from the trading process.
How AI Quantitative Trading Works
AI quantitative trading algorithms typically work in the following three steps:
- Data collection: The algorithm collects a large amount of historical data, such as price data, volume data, and financial indicators.
- Model training: The algorithm uses the historical data to train a model that can predict future price movements.
- Trading signal generation: The algorithm uses the trained model to generate trading signals.
- Trade execution: The algorithm executes the trading signals.
Types of AI Quantitative Trading Strategies
There are a number of different types of AI quantitative trading strategies, including:
- Machine learning strategies: Machine learning strategies use machine learning algorithms to learn from historical data and generate trading signals.
- Natural language processing (NLP) strategies: NLP strategies use NLP algorithms to extract insights from news articles, social media posts, and other text-based data.
- Deep learning strategies: Deep learning strategies use deep learning algorithms to learn complex patterns from historical data and generate trading signals.
Challenges of AI Quantitative Trading
Despite the benefits of AI quantitative trading, there are also a number of challenges associated with it, including:
- Complexity: AI quantitative trading algorithms are typically very complex, and they can be difficult to develop and maintain.
- Data requirements: AI quantitative trading algorithms typically require a large amount of historical data to train.
- Overfitting: AI quantitative trading algorithms can overfit to the historical data, which can lead to poor performance in real-time trading.
